Understanding Parrot Behavior
Parrots are extremely social creatures that require interaction, mental stimulation, and an appropriate environment to grow. Different types of parrots have differing requirements, but there prevail care concepts applicable to nearly all kinds of pet parrots.

Table 1: Common Parrot Species and Their Characteristics
SpeciesAverage LifespanSizeSocial NeedsBudgerigar (Budgie)5-10 years7 inchesHighLovebird10-15 years5-7 inchesModerate to HighCockatiel10-15 years12-14 inchesModerateAfrican Grey Parrot40-60 years12-14 inchesVery HighMacaw30-50 years24-36 inchesExtremely HighEstablishing a Comfortable HabitatCage Selection
The cage is the parrot's home and plays a vital function in their wellness. When picking a cage, consider the following:
Size: The larger the cage, the much better. Parrots require area to extend their wings and move around. A minimum size for small parrots (like budgies) is 18x18x24 inches, while bigger species (like macaws) need at least 36x24x48 inches.Bar Spacing: Ensure that the bars are spaced properly to avoid escape or injury. Smaller parrots need narrower spacing, while bigger birds require larger spacing.Products: Opt for stainless steel or powder-coated cages as they are more long lasting and safe; prevent cages made from harmful products.Cage Setup
When the cage is picked, it's necessary to set it up thoughtfully:
Perches: Provide perches of differing diameter and natural wood sets down to promote foot health.Toys: Invest in a variety of toys that motivate psychological stimulation and decrease monotony. Chewing toys, puzzles, and foraging toys are fantastic alternatives.Food and Water Dishes: Use stainless steel or ceramic bowls that are simple to tidy. Fresh food and water must be readily available day-to-day.Diet plan: The Key to Health

Essentials of a Parrot DietPellets: Commercial pellets must form the base of your parrot's diet. They are nutritionally balanced and provide essential minerals and vitamins.Vegetables and fruits: Fresh fruits (like apples, bananas, and berries) and vegetables (like carrots, greens, and peppers) need to consist of about 20-25% of their diet plan. Be mindful of foods that are poisonous to parrots, such as avocado or chocolate.Seeds and Nuts: Seeds and nuts can be given as deals with but should not form the bulk of their diet plan due to high-fat content.Fresh Water: Always supply clean, fresh water. Modification the water everyday to avoid bacterial development.

It is suggested to clean up the cage a minimum of once a week, but day-to-day cleaning of food and water meals is important to maintain health.
2. Can parrots live alone?
While some parrots can adapt to being alone, they are extremely social animals and gain from friendship. Think about adopting a second parrot or spending ample time engaging with your bird.
3. How do I know if my parrot is ill?
Signs of disease include changes in behavior, loss of appetite, sleepiness, fluffed feathers, and modifications in droppings. If any of these symptoms take place, consult an avian vet promptly.
4. Are there any foods I should avoid feeding my parrot?
Yes, avoid foods like avocado, chocolate, caffeine, and alcohol, as they can be hazardous to parrots.
5. How can I ensure my parrot gets enough exercise?
Offer lots of out-of-cage time for flying and playing, together with toys and perches in their cage that encourage motion.
